Srinagar : Union Minister reviews progress of work on various development projects in Srinagar; interacts with beneficiaries of different Central Government schemes.
The Union Minister for Petroleum and Natural Gas and Housing and Urban Affairs, Sh. Hardeep Singh Puri on Monday said that the Prime Minister’s commitment to the development of J&K is turning into reality and work regarding the same is in full swing. He stated that the PM’s development initiatives in J&K have created an emotional bond between the people and the country. “Central schemes directly benefit the people and I am glad that work is going on at the ground level,” the minister added.
